Why should you open an account With LIBC? There are a number of reasons that any individual, corporation, or state would wish to protect and grow its assets. LIBC guarantees every cent placed within its vaults, and the Tenpenny Holding Co. insures this money in case of bank insolvency, which protects the consumer in every possible outcome. State of the art defence technology is used to keep your money safe, from the thickest vaults to employing the best computer hackers to set up lines of defence for our online banking. LIBC also always maintains at minimum 50% of its clients assets on hand. Most banks only keep a mere 5-10%(10% being very rare) of their clients' deposits on hand, loaning out the rest of the money in the interim. While in most cases this is safe, many bank failures and recessions have been caused by bad returns on bank made loans and investments, leading to a loss in the principal deposits. At LIBC such a high reserve of deposited money means that your principal is always safe, on top of being insured by the Tenpenny Holding Co.

This protection is very useful for private organizations that wish to keep their money safe from thieves and natural accidents, like fires. States also need a reliable bank to store their funds with, as it frees up public space and provides a safe haven in case of invasion or rebellion.

The concern we have with providing a loan to you is that your total GDP is $1,038,643,640,963.35, with you taking 55% of that per year in taxation, which equals 571,254,002,529.8425 in annual government income. Naturally this is divied up already between most of your branches, especially if you are in a time of trouble. The only area for cuts that I can see if you are facing lawlessness are administration, of which I could only account for a 25% cut which would only be roughly 10% of your total tax income. This gives you essentially only $57 Billion per year to pay LIBC back, at which rate a loan of $100 Trillion would be highly infeasible for both parties involved. If you wish for a smaller amount you can re-apply. Thank you for your consideration.
